War Rage

War Rage

Franchises
War Rage

Discover Games

Summary

War Rage is an action game made by chinese developer Booming Games.

Franchises
War Rage

Community

Games metadata is powered by IGDB.com

War Rage News

My drummer has this story he tells sometimes, about this one time when he was drumming in some other band, and some

By

August 2009

Advertisement

When Oblivion and Doom meet, the Fallout is bound to yield surprises; and perhaps offer some insight into the future

Advertisement

May 2009

Advertisement